The taste and aroma of these flavorful, cheesy pull apart rolls are sure to please the entire family whether for a special occasion or relaxing weekend brunch.
This recipe is made with Jones Golden Brown® Mild Links.
12 frozen dinner rolls, thawed* 4 tablespoons butter, melted Seasonings to taste (recommended combination: sesame seeds, poppy seeds, paprika, minced onion, freeze-dried chives) 1/3 cup milk 10 large eggs, beaten 2 green onions, finely chopped Salt and pepper, to taste 10 ounces Jones Dairy Farm All Natural Golden Brown Breakfast Sausage Links, chopped 3 cups cheddar cheese, shredded *Substitute frozen par-baked dinner rolls or refrigerated bread dough.
Brush or roll thawed dough in butter, sprinkle with desired seasonings. Reserve any remaining butter and use to brush on finished rolls after assembly. Place rolls in 10-inch cake pan that has been thoroughly coated with non-stick spray. Flatten dough until rolls are just touching each other. Allow rolls to rise until doubled in size, according to package directions. Bake according to package directions (15 – 20 minutes) until lightly browned. Once slightly cooled, remove from pan and place on baking sheet lined with parchment paper or aluminum foil. While rolls are baking, combine milk, eggs and green onions. Season with salt and pepper. Cook in non-stick skillet over medium heat until eggs are just set, soft scrambled; set aside. Cook sausage according to package directions; set aside.
Preheat oven to 350°F. Using bread knife cut rolls in half horizontally creating a large “bun.” Layer half cheese on bottom, add scrambled egg mixture, then sausage. Top with remaining cheese. Place top “bun” over filling and press down gently. Brush top and sides with remaining butter. Bake for 15 minutes or until heated throughout. Serve immediately.
